Clinical course of obstructive jaundice associated with operated meconium peritonitis in neonates

Meconium peritonitis (MP) can cause prolonged jaundice in infants. Most cases resolve with conservative treatment, but imaging is crucial to rule out biliary atresia (BA) in persistent cases.

Background:

  • Meconium peritonitis (MP) is a rare neonatal condition that can lead to prolonged cholestasis post-laparotomy.
  • Obstructive jaundice, including biliary atresia (BA), is a potential complication in infants with MP.

Purpose of the Study:

  • To retrospectively analyze the clinical course of infants with MP.
  • To investigate the association between MP and the development of obstructive jaundice.
  • To differentiate MP-associated jaundice from biliary atresia (BA).

Main Methods:

  • Retrospective review of 23 infants with MP who underwent laparotomy between 1979 and 2008.
  • Analysis of clinical data for 11 infants who developed postoperative obstructive jaundice.
  • Utilized ultrasonography, HIDA scintigraphy, and open cholangiography for diagnosis.

Main Results:

  • Of 23 infants with MP, 11 (47.8%) developed obstructive jaundice.
  • Jejunoileal atresia was the underlying cause in 10 infants; cloacal anomaly in 1.
  • Nine of 11 infants improved with conservative management; 2 required further investigation for BA.

Conclusions:

  • Postoperative cholestasis following meconium peritonitis is typically transient.
  • Ultrasonography and HIDA scintigraphy are essential to differentiate BA in infants with MP and prolonged jaundice with acholic stools.

Jaundice

Jaundice, or icterus, is the yellow discoloration of the skin, sclerae, and mucous membranes. It happens when plasma bilirubin levels rise above 2.5-3 mg/dL, leading to bilirubin deposition in tissue.Bilirubin is a byproduct of hemoglobin degradation. In macrophages, hemoglobin breaks down into globin and heme.
